    Which is best among Internal 500 GB HD or External 500 GB HD
    Hai,


    Just I proposed to buy one 500 GB Hard Dist for my Win XP/1GB RAM PC to store more data. Kindly clarify which is the best one Internal or External ?

    Each has its advantages. Also, the advantages depend on the interface used to connect. Often external drives have USB or Firewire interfaces. Internal drives are IDE (ATA) or SATA. SATA is the more common in newer computers. Yours may have an older IDE interface. These interfaces transfer data at different speeds.

    Sometimes external hard drives tend to spontaneously disconnect. That can be a problem if you're assuming it will be constantly turned on.

    External drives can be disconnected from the computer and taken elsewhere with relative ease. That's great for backing up when it's desirable to unplug the hard drive and store in a safe place.
